The bq2084-V140 saves the new FCC value to the data flash within 4 seconds of being updated. The bq2084-V140 monitors the battery for three low-voltage thresholds, EDV0, EDV1, and EDV2. The EDV thresholds can be programmed for determination based on the overall pack voltage or an individual cell level. The EDVV bit in Pack Configuration DF 0x28 configures the bq2084-V140 for overall voltage or single-cell EDV thresholds. If programmed for single-cell EDV determination, the bq2084-V140 determines EDV on the basis of the lowest single-cell voltage. Fixed EDV thresholds must be programmed in EMF/EDV0 DF 0x95-0x96, EDV C0 Factor/EDV1 DF 0x97-0x98, and EDV R Factor/EDV2 DF 0x99-0x9a. If the CEDV bit in Gauge Configuration DF 0x29 is set, automatic compensated EDVs are enabled and the bq2084-V140 computes the EDV0, EDV1, and EDV2 voltage thresholds based on the values in DF 0x95-0xa0 and the battery's current discharge rate and temperature. If FEDV0 in Gauge Configuration is also set then EDV0 is not compensated. The bq2084-V140 disables EDV detection if Current( ) exceeds the Overload Current threshold programmed in DF 0x5b-DF 0x5c. The bq2084-V140 resumes EDV threshold detection after Current( ) drops below the Overload Current threshold. Any EDV threshold detected is reset after charge is detected and VDQ is cleared after 10 mAh of charge. The bq2084-V140 uses the EDV thresholds to apply voltage-based corrections to the RM register according to Table 2. Table 2. State-of-Charge Based on Low Battery Voltage THRESHOLD RELATIVE STATE OF CHARGE EDV0 0% EDV1 3% EDV2 Battery Low % The bq2084-V140 performs EDV-based RM adjustments with Current() ≤ C/32. No EDV flags are set if current < C/32. The bq2084-V140 adjusts RM as it detects each threshold. If the voltage threshold is reached before the corresponding capacity on discharge, the bq2084-V140 reduces RM to the appropriate amount as shown in Table 2. If an RM % level is reached on discharge before the voltage reaches the corresponding threshold, then RM is held at that % level until the threshold is reached. RM is only held if VDQ = 1, indicating a valid learning cycle is in progress. If Battery Low % is set to zero, EDV1 and EDV0 corrections are disabled. The bq2084-V140 uses the values stored in data flash for the EDV0, EDV1, and EDV2 values or calculates the three thresholds from a base value and the temperature, capacity, and rate adjustment factors stored in data flash. If EDV compensation is disabled, then EDV0, EDV1, and EDV2 are stored directly in mV in DF 0x95-0x96, DF 0x97-0x98, and DF 0x99-0x9a, respectively. For capacity correction at EDV2, Battery Low % DF 0x2f can be set at a desired state-of-charge, STATEOFCHARGE%, in the range of 3-19%. Typical values for STATEOFCHARGE% are 5-7%, representing 5-7% capacity. Battery Low % = (STATEOFCHARGE% x 2.56) 11 Submit Documentation Feedback |
